基于移动智能终端的虚拟径赛运动播报方法技术

技术编号:11418125 阅读:64 留言:0更新日期:2015-05-06 19:25
本发明专利技术公开了一种基于移动智能终端的虚拟径赛运动播报方法,步骤包括:(1)终端数据的实时采集、(2)数据预处理、(3)数据回传、(4)数据解析、(5)赛况播报和(6)赛事结果留存。通过上述方式,本发明专利技术基于移动智能终端的虚拟径赛运动播报方法,通过竞赛的方式让运动者可以互动起来,让所有的运动参与者都有现场感,从而带来更好地运动体验。

【技术实现步骤摘要】

本专利技术涉及运动系统领域,特别是涉及一种基于移动智能终端的虚拟径赛运动播报方法
技术介绍
跑步、自行车等径赛类运动(跑步、快走、骑行等)是个人健身最肯能被选择的方式,随着智能手机等终端设备的普及,市面上已经出现了帮助运动者记录径赛类运动轨迹,查询运动数据的等功能的移动应用。这些应用的出现,帮助健身者记录运动历程,增强了一些乐趣,但是这样的应用仅仅是简单地运动数据记录,而不能够提供运动中最重要的属性:竞争,这让运动的运动者的乐趣和热情减少了很多。如果能在运动过程中增加一定的竞技性,则更能发挥运动者的热情,并能提高运动效果。现实生活中,个人很难每天都去组织跑步等运动竞赛。
技术实现思路
本专利技术主要解决的技术问题是提供一种基于移动智能终端的虚拟径赛运动播报方法,具有可靠性高、定位精确、使用方便、功能多样等优点,同时在运动系统的应用及普及上有着广泛的市场前景。为解决上述技术问题,本专利技术采用的一个技术方案是:提供一种基于移动智能终端的虚拟径赛运动播报方法,其步骤包括:(1)终端数据的实时采集:(1.1)用户登录客户端,并本文档来自技高网...
基于移动智能终端的虚拟径赛运动播报方法

【技术保护点】
一种基于移动智能终端的虚拟径赛运动播报方法,其特征在于,步骤包括:(1)终端数据的实时采集:(1.1)用户登录客户端,并在客户端中选择需要加入的比赛;客户端为用户生成一个唯一的临时识别码;客户端获取比赛ID和临时识别码,并将这两个信息传送回赛事服务模块;赛事服务模块接收比赛ID和临时识别码,并根据接收比赛ID和临时识别码为用户分配一个流水编号,同时将流水编号和临时识别码关联起来;(1.2)用户在同步服务模块设置比赛的开始方式和开始时间;当到达比赛开始的时间点或用户启动比赛时,同步服务模块开始工作,首先推送一个测试报文到客户端,客户端收到测试报文后立即将测试报文原封回复给同步服务模块;同步服务模...

【技术特征摘要】
1.一种基于移动智能终端的虚拟径赛运动播报方法,其特征在于,步骤包括:
(1)终端数据的实时采集:
(1.1)用户登录客户端,并在客户端中选择需要加入的比赛;客户端为用户生成一个唯一的临时识别码;客户端获取比赛ID和临时识别码,并将这两个信息传送回赛事服务模块;赛事服务模块接收比赛ID和临时识别码,并根据接收比赛ID和临时识别码为用户分配一个流水编号,同时将流水编号和临时识别码关联起来;
(1.2)用户在同步服务模块设置比赛的开始方式和开始时间;当到达比赛开始的时间点或用户启动比赛时,同步服务模块开始工作,首先推送一个测试报文到客户端,客户端收到测试报文后立即将测试报文原封回复给同步服务模块;同步服务模块根据每个客户端的回复时间判断各个客户端的网络延迟;当同步服务模块获取了所有客户端的网络延迟数据后,推算出各客户端的同步修正值,利用同步修正值将所有客户端的位置更新数据在同一时刻到达数据服务模块;例如有两个客户端,网络延迟分别是200ms和400ms,则后一个客户端的同步修正值为-200,它需要每次提前200毫秒发送位置报告,这样两个客户端的位置报告发送到服务器的时间点就会是一致的;
(2)数据预处理:
(2.1)同步服务模块根据比赛类型来选择位置报告的同步间隔,并将同步间隔及计算出的同步修正值发送给所有客户端;每当客户端同步状态不一致并且超出允许误差时,重复计算同步修正值并更新给所有客户端;
(2.2)客户端根据同步服务模块推送的同步间隔以及同步修正值,定期收集用户的当前位置信息;客户端对用户的当前位置信息加上时间戳以及临时识别码后进行压缩,得到位置报告;
(3)数据回传:客户端将位置报告定期加密后传回给数据服务模块;
(4)数据解析:
...

【专利技术属性】
技术研发人员:孙国清
申请(专利权)人:趣动信息科技苏州有限公司
类型:发明
国别省市:江苏;32

相关技术
    暂无相关专利
网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1